Crash on the A137 - 31 Jul 1987
Accident reference 1987371112900
Accident summary
On Friday 31 July 1987 at 22:00 a slight collision occurred near A137 involving 2 vehicles and 1 casualty (1 slight) Weather at the time was recorded as fine no high winds. Road surface conditions were dry. Lighting was described as darkness - lights lit.
